What is a UKG Implementation?

A UKG Implementation job involves configuring, deploying, and optimizing UKG (Ultimate Kronos Group) software solutions for businesses. Professionals in this role work closely with clients to assess their needs, customize the system, and ensure a smooth transition. They provide training, troubleshoot issues, and support data migration to maximize system efficiency. Strong project management, technical expertise, and communication skills are essential for success in this role.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one in a UKG Implementation role?

As a UKG Implementation professional, your day often involves gathering client requirements, configuring UKG software to align with business processes, and troubleshooting technical issues. You’ll collaborate closely with clients, project managers, and technical teams to ensure successful rollouts and address any challenges that arise. Regular tasks include running discovery sessions, mapping data, testing system functionality, and providing user training. This role offers a dynamic work environment with opportunities to build client relationships and deepen your expertise in enterprise HR technology.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the UKG Implementation position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a UKG Implementation professional, you need expertise in HR/payroll processes, project management, and a solid understanding of software deployment methodologies, typically supported by experience with enterprise HR systems. Familiarity with UKG (formerly Kronos) applications, data integration tools, and related certifications like PMP or UKG-specific credentials are highly valuable. Strong communication, problem-solving skills, and the ability to manage multiple stakeholders make candidates stand out. These qualifications are crucial for ensuring smooth implementation projects that meet client needs, stay on schedule, and align with organizational goals.

About the Role

The Director, Corporate Communications - Operations is responsible for building and managing the “operating system” for the Corporate Communications function. This role serves as the strategy and operations partner to the Chief Communications Officer (CCO), ensuring the organization delivers high-impact communication with consistency, discipline, and scalability. This leader establishes the structures, processes, and systems that enable communications strategy to thrive—ensuring that all team efforts, from global campaigns to major company events, are effectively prioritized, resourced, executed, and measured against company priorities.

Duties and Responsibilities

Strategy Integration & Program Management:

  • Lead the development and evolution of the Corporate Communications annual strategy, ensuring objectives and KPIs are aligned to company priorities

  • Own the program management of high-impact, large-scale communications initiatives, including global campaigns, product launches, and major company events

  • Drive strong cross-functional alignment across Product, Marketing, HR, and Global Business Operations from intake through execution

Resourcing & Operational Architecture:

  • Define and manage the Corporate Communications resourcing model, balancing internal headcount, agency support, and vendor partnerships

  • Establish and continuously optimize planning, intake, and prioritization processes to ensure focus on the highest-impact initiatives

  • Serve as the primary prioritization lead, aligning team capacity and execution to enterprise priorities

Performance, Insights & Data Strategy:

  • Develop and maintain a Communications scorecard to track performance, measure impact, and inform decision-making

  • Translate complex data into clear, actionable insights for the CCO and executive leadership team

  • Own the Communications analytics and insights capability, including reporting infrastructure, data modeling, and performance analysis

Systems & AI Enablement:

  • Own the Communications technology roadmap, advancing the function from manual and siloed workflows to a more integrated and scalable infrastructure

  • Implement standardized workflows and tools that improve efficiency, visibility, and execution across the function

  • Drive adoption of AI-enabled solutions to streamline processes and enhance team productivity

Strategic Bandwidth Management & Operating Rhythm:

  • Act as the central intake point for communications requests, ensuring alignment to strategic priorities and effective use of team capacity

  • Develop and manage a communications calendar and operating rhythm to track and report on major initiatives and milestones

  • Partner closely with the CCO and Executive Assistant to align leadership priorities, time allocation, and team execution

Basic Qualifications
  • 5+ years of professional experience as a Director or Sr. Manager in strategy & operations inside of a corporate communications team

  • Background working within a technology organization, SAAS preferred

  • Proven experience leading complex, cross-functional programs, operating models, or large-scale communications initiatives while influencing senior stakeholders

  • Strong analytical capabilities and experience translating data into actionable, executive-level insights

  • Experience designing and implementing operating processes, workflows, and team cadences

  • Ability to manage multiple high-priority initiatives in a fast-paced, global environment
